Debarred Person means a Person that is: (a) debarred from or disqualified under the Act or any other governmental program; (b) on any of the FDA clinical investigator enforcement lists (including, the (i) Disqualified/Totally Restricted List, (ii) Restricted List and (iii) Adequate Assurances List); or (c) excluded from participation in any governmental healthcare program or other federal or state program, convicted of an offense under 42 U.S.C § 1320a-7, or otherwise deemed ineligible for participation in health care or federal or state programs.

Debarred Person means any person (i) debarred or suspended under Section 306 of the FD&C ACT or (ii) listed in the Department of Health and Human Services List of Excluded Individuals/Entities or the General Services Administration’s Listing of Parties excluded from Federal Procurement and Non-Procurement Programs. Debarred Person means any person subject to limitations or any form of endorsement imposed upon clinical investigators or clinical study sites by the European Medicines Evaluation Agency (EMEA), the US Food and Drug Administration (FDA) (including persons required to be listed under Section 306(k)(2) of the Act), or any Regulatory Authority or other recognized national, multi-national, or industry body.
